ACME Engineering Products is saddened to announce the passing of our president and co-founder, Steve Presser. Acme was created in partnership with Steve’s father, Jacob in 1956 and they worked together until Jacob’s death in 1974. Beginning as an importer and distributor of European plumbing and HVAC controls, Acme began manufacturing electric hot water and steam boilers in the 1960s and gas detection equipment in the 1970s. Always an innovator, under his leadership he was a pioneer in the promotion of electrode boilers in the 1980s in Quebec, taking advantage of attractive electricity rates for large commercial, industrial and institutional consumers. Together with his son Robert since 1993, Acme added the manufacturing of automatic strainers for water and wastewater filtration. Together, they expanded Acme's operations overseas with a joint venture in India and technology partnerships in China and Europe. Always treating his employees with respect and affection, he considered all of them as his Acme family. He leaves behind a rich legacy of technical and commercial achievement and will be deeply missed by his family, friends, colleagues and clients.
